- The distance between Atbara, Sudan and Hull, England, Uk is approximately 4,969 km or 3,088 mi.
- To reach Atbara in this distance one would set out from Hull, England bearing 130.4° or SE and follow the great circles arc to approach Atbara bearing 151.8° or SSE .
- Atbara has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Hull, England has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Atbara is in or near the tropical desert biome whereas Hull, England is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The annual average temperature is 19.9 °C (35.8°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.1 °C (0.2°F) less in Atbara.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
- Total annual precipitation averages 582.1 mm (22.9 in) less which is equivalent to 582.1 l/m² (14.29 US gal/ft²) or 5,821,000 l/ha (622,304 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 34.1° higher in Atbara than in Hull, England.
- Relative humidity levels are 50%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 3.1°C (5.6°F) higher.
